Understanding the Different Types of Threat Monitoring Tools
A variety of threat monitoring tools are available, each with unique functionalities and strengths. Choosing the right tool depends on the specific needs and resources of the organization.
Network Monitoring Tools
These tools monitor network traffic for unusual patterns or activities that could indicate a malicious attack. They often identify suspicious connections, unusual data transfers, and potential intrusions. Examples include Wireshark and tcpdump.
Endpoint Detection and Response (EDR) Tools
EDR tools focus on protecting individual devices, such as computers and mobile phones. They monitor system activity, detect malicious software, and provide capabilities for incident response. Examples include CrowdStrike Falcon and Carbon Black.
Security Information and Event Management (SIEM) Systems
SIEM systems collect and analyze security logs from various sources across an organization's IT infrastructure. They provide a centralized view of security events, helping to identify potential threats and correlate them with other information. Examples include Splunk and QRadar.
Security Orchestration, Automation, and Response (SOAR) Platforms
SOAR platforms automate security tasks, such as incident response workflows and threat hunting. They streamline incident handling, enabling quicker responses to security incidents and reducing the impact of attacks. Examples include Demisto and Palo Alto Networks Cortex XSOAR.
Key Features and Capabilities of Threat Monitoring Tools
Effective threat monitoring tools offer a range of features that contribute to a robust cybersecurity posture.
Real-Time Threat Detection
The ability to detect threats in real-time is crucial. Advanced tools use machine learning and AI to identify anomalies and suspicious activities as they occur. This proactive approach allows for swift response and minimizes the potential for damage.
Automated Threat Response
Many modern threat monitoring tools offer automated responses to threats. This automation can include isolating compromised systems, blocking malicious traffic, and initiating incident response procedures. This automation significantly reduces response time and minimizes the impact of an attack.
Integration with Existing Systems
Integrating with existing security systems is vital for a comprehensive approach. A well-integrated system ensures that all security data is collected and analyzed, providing a holistic view of potential threats.
Customizable Reporting and Dashboards
Customizable reporting and dashboards provide valuable insights into security events. These reports help security teams understand threats, prioritize vulnerabilities, and make informed decisions.
